## Authentication

The billing worker (Tallygrove) uses blue-green deploys, and both colors authenticate against the internal ledger gateway with the same service key. During cutover, verify the idle color can reach the gateway before shifting traffic; a failed auth check will abort the swap automatically. If you are paged for a stuck cutover, confirm the key matches the one issued below.

API key for fahip-kahip: zpat23_XiJGUHz5xfaAtaIqUkus0rh

FAQ: What if I'm locked out of the Hueledger audit workspace?

Contractors running the color-contrast audit for the Marrowgate redesign sometimes lose access after the weekly permission sweep. Don't create a new account; that breaks audit attribution. Instead, open the Hueledger recovery prompt, confirm your assigned component list, and enter the team passphrase printed directly beneath this answer.

unlock words, bagug-kadup: wenath-zorael

**Handover — Fareloom rules engine**

Hey, quick brain dump before I'm out. Fareloom computes shipping fees from a rule set that merchants edit through the Cartwell dashboard. The engine reloads rules every few minutes; if fees look stale, that interval is usually the culprit. Watch the evaluation timeout too — complex rule trees on the Brindleport tenant have tripped it twice this month. Everything is tunable without a deploy, thankfully. If you get paged, start by comparing the live settings against the known-good set below.

settings of fafog-haduf:
ZORIX_PIN=4648
ZORIX_METRICS_HOST=metrics.zorix.paliqsys.corp
ZORIX_LOG_LEVEL=info
ZORIX_TENANT=druix